Abstract:
The present invention provides for the use of activator complexes to enhance lower temperature cleaning in alkaline peroxide cleaning systems. Compositions including at least one of an activator complex, an active oxygen source, and a source of alkalinity are applied to the surface to be cleaned at temperatures between about 5°C and about 50°C. The methods and compositions of the present invention provide for enhanced soil removal with reduced energy, water, and chemistry consumption.

Abstract:
A detergent powder composition comprising an anionic and or nonionic surfactant, a bleach and a stain-removal enhancer selected from N-(optionally substituted) acyl-N-(C5C31) hydrocarbyl polyhydroxy amides, alkyl aldonamides, alkyl or alkenyl glycasuccinimides and N-(optionally substituted) aminoalkyl polyhydroxy fatty acid amides.

Abstract:
A bleaching detergent composition which prevents or inhibits tarnishing of silver comprises: (a) a bleaching agent selected from a peroxygen or peroxygen-yielding compound, a hypohalite or hypohalite-yielding compound, or a salt thereof, or mixtures thereof; (b) an anti-tarnishing agent selected from: (i) a purine class compound; (ii) cyanuric acid or isocyanuric acid or a salt thereof; (iii) a 1,3-N azole compound; (iv) a mixture of any of the above compounds (i), (ii) or (iii); (c) optionally a builder; (d) optionally, a surfactant; wherein the composition exhibits a pH value in the range from 7 to 13, and wherein the anti-tarnishing agent has a pKa value below the pH value of an aqueous solution of the composition.
Abstract:
A peracid bleaching species is formed in situ in aqueous wash liquor by reaction of a peroxygen bleach precursor, such as perborate or percarbonate, and a bleach activator. The bleach activator is an acetylated ethylene diamine, that comprises at least 25% triacetyl ethylene diamine. The peracid is formed more rapidly even at low temperatures (F2) compared to use of conventional pure tetracetyl ethylene diamine (F1) and better disinfectant properties result.
Abstract:
Stabilized peroxygen containing compositions are disclosed, both in thickened viscous form and in dry form. The compositions contain newly synthesized calcium sulfate crystals that function as a thickener and stabilizing agent against metal-catalyzed decomposition. The invention discloses a composition comprising 0.5 wt % to 50 % wt of hydrogen peroxide, 2.0 wt % to 80.0 % wt of newly synthesized calcium sulfate crystals, being of individual sheet or needle shape, and water, said composition having a viscosity of 200 cP to 20,000 cP. The invention further provides a process for making same, comprising the reaction of a water soluble calcium containing salt with sulfuric acid or a salt thereof in an aqueous hydrogen peroxide solution at a reaction temperature of up to 80°C in a mixing apparatus, followed by a concentration step in order to thicken into a stable viscous dispersion or paste containing at least 2 wt % and preferably 10 wt % to 15 wt % of CaSO 4 . The compositions are suitable for use as disinfectants, as cleaning agents, and in a variety of personal care, pharmaceutical, textile bleaching and industrial applications.
